**Onboarding: StageView seat maps**

Welcome! StageView is the renderer that draws seat maps for the Gilded Lark Theatre's booking flow. When customers report a "grey seat" or a section that won't load, it's usually a stale layout cache — the fix is re-running the layout sync job, not editing seats by hand. Layouts, holds, and pricing tiers all live in one database the renderer reads on every request, reachable via the connection string below.

replica DSN, kajep-yahag: mssql://praok_svc:iF@db-8d68.plorvaio.local:5432/eliion

This confirms the schedule for the Ellsworth Group relocation into the Carrowgate building next Tuesday. Crates arrive in three waves starting 07:30; the receiving site should keep loading dock 2 clear through midday. Furniture follows Wednesday. All crates carry colour-coded labels matching the floor plan posted in the lobby, and the move manifest travels with the lead vehicle. One consignment of sealed records crates requires special handling, and the following applies to that courier hand-over.

courier memo of yawep-yafog: the pramir ulaix courier leaves the ulavan aldix frair zorok oliiel joreth rusdor fenvan ledger at gate 1305 under passcode 514738

MEMO — Harwick Analytics: New Subscription Tier

To: Sales leads

We launch the "Crestline" tier next quarter. Sits between Standard and Enterprise. Includes priority routing, two advisory hours monthly, and the Penrose reporting module. Pricing lands 30 percent above Standard. No discounting beyond 10 percent without my approval. Target: mid-market accounts stuck on Standard overages. Battlecards ship Friday; training call Monday. Do not pitch externally before launch date. Positioning rationale is in the note below.

internal memo for kawip-hadug: Headcount on the Wenwyn team goes from 7 to 140 by the end of January. Gross margin on Wenwyn came in at 20 percent against a plan of 15 percent.